Overall Meaning

The lyrics of Alarum's song "Realization" speak of self-discovery, inner conflicts, and the struggle to find one's place and purpose in the world. The song begins with the singer acknowledging past regrets but emphasizes the importance of making the right choices in the present. The mention of being "between myselves" suggests a struggle with multiple identities or aspects of oneself that may not always be in harmony. The line "you see, but not show like me" implies that the singer feels misunderstood or unable to fully express themselves.


The song then explores the power of imagination and the different dimensions of reality that can be accessed through it. The reference to "time split" could mean the ability to manipulate time or experience reality in a non-linear way. The mention of "coke" is intriguing as it could refer to either the drug or to the drink, but in either case, it suggests an altered state of consciousness. The singer's anger is also mentioned, and their sense of superiority towards others is reflected in the line "my anger ten times taller than your head."


The lyrics then turn to the themes of manipulation and influence, questioning who or what is responsible for shaping our thoughts and behaviors. The "window of the soul" is described as the place where contact is made, perhaps referring to our interactions with others or with the deeper parts of ourselves. The song ends with the idea that true realization can only come from within, and that love and change are essential for growth.
